  • Tentative state budget includes ‘Jimmy Fallon’ tax credit to lure ‘The Tonight Show’ back to NY

    03/21/2013 6:36:26 PM PDT · by NoLibZone · 4 replies
    nydailynews.com ^ | March 21 2013 | Ken Lovett
    Budget documents state that ‘a talk or variety program’ that gets the credit ‘must be filmed before a studio audience’ of at least 200, have a production budget of at least $30 million or run at least $10 million in capital expenses — and has to have been shot outside New York for at least 5 seasons prior to relocation. New York already gives companies producing movies or television series in the state a tax credit equal to 30% of production costs. It costs the state $420 million in revenue a year.
